Abstract

Aut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a long-standing neurodevelopmental condition with prominent effects on social behavior of affected children. This disorder has been linked with neuroinflammatory responses. NF-κB has been shown to affect these responses in the orbitofrontal cortex of patients with ASD, thus being implicated in the pathogenesis of ASD. We measured expression of some NF-κB-associated lncRNAs and mRNAs ( and ) in the peripheral blood of ASD kids vs. healthy children. Expression of none of genes has been correlated with age of healthy children. Among this group of children, expression levels of and were robustly correlated ( = 0.83, < 0.0001). had the greatest AUC value (AUC = 0.857), thus the best diagnostic power among the assessed genes. ranked the second position in this regard (AUC = 0.757). Thus, NF-κB-associated lncRNAs might partake in the pathogenesis of ASD.
